Development of Web3 Awareness Scale as the Next Evolution of the Internet

Abstract

Web3, characterized by its decentralization, user autonomy, and integration of blockchain technologies, introduces a novel ecosystem that is rife with both opportunities and complexities. While these advances are rewriting the conventional norms of digital interaction and data management, they are also ushering in a new set of challenges and learning curves. We introduce the "Web3 Awareness Scale" as a main element through the current study. This carefully designed scale assesses university students' understanding and readiness for the emerging landscape of Web3. Whilst the article provides detailed insights into the technical, real-world applications and challenges of Web3, the inclusion of the scale emphasizes the practical assessment of awareness and readiness among key digital natives - students. As a result of the EFA, 6 items were removed from the scale, and the total explained variance of the two-factor structure consisted of 31. The final version of the scale showed a total explained variation of 64.16%. Specifically, the first factor, Opportunities, accounted for 46.94% of the variance, while the second factor, Risks, accounted for 17.21% of the variance. It is found that the coefficients of all factors indicate a very highly reliable measurement. The interpretation is that both the total scale and each factor have a high level of reliability. The findings from the scale are critical and have the potential to provide invaluable insights. These insights are expected to shape future educational curricula and policy-making, ensuring that the next generation is well-equipped to navigate and exploit the opportunities of Web3.
